摘要

Abstract

A rapid, facile and effective method for the preparation of anthraquinone derivatives was reported in this article. The anthraquinone derivatives were synthesized from the reaction of aromatic compounds with phthalic anhydride in the presence of AlCl_3/PPA or AlCl_3/H_2SO_4 as a catalyst under microwave heat-ing. In addition,the effects of different types of catalysts on the reaction yield were investigated. The re-suits indicated that AlCl_3/H_2SO_4 was a good catalyst for the synthesis of anthraquinone derivatives with e-lectron donating group. Whereas, AlCl_3/PPA was a good catalyst for substituted benzenes with electron withdrawing groups. These compounds have been characterized by UV, IR,~1H NMR and MS.
